Batista has worked hard to establish himself as one of the greatest Superstars in WWE’s history. He has squared off against the best of the best the WWE had to offer, including The Undertaker, John Cena and also Triple H. Triple H also gave Batista huge props for a good reason.

Batista’s final match was against Triple H at WrestleMania 35, where he would lose to The Game. The 53-year-old is a six-time world champion and a two-time Royal Rumble winner.

He is a future WWE Hall Of Famer and many fans and pro wrestlers alike appreciate him. On the occasion of his 20th Anniversary since his WWE debut, Triple H took to Twitter and gave Batista huge props for evolving over the years.

“In the 20 years since @DaveBautista was first introduced to the @WWE Universe, he has never stopped growing and evolving. A main event player, multi-time champion and Hollywood star, one thing has stayed the same: he never stopped chasing his dreams. Congratulations Dave! #Proud
